Am I eligible for exemptions?

Exemptions are awarded to students who have previously completed other qualifications such as HETAC, BTEC or equivalent and Irish honours degree holders of a relevant subject area may be entitled to exemptions from our qualification.

Our exemption policy

All exemption applications are assessed on an individual basis and exemptions are only granted from First Year subjects on the course. Accounting Technicians Ireland can only offer exemptions on the basis of qualifications awarded in the last 10 years.

Exemptions must be applied for before you register with Accounting Technicians Ireland as a student and cannot be awarded if you have registered with us in a previous year. Exemptions are only valid when you have fully registered with Accounting Technicians Ireland and all fees have been paid.
